前言:
现时各位老铁们对“每天5分钟玩转docker容器技术 pdf百度云”大体比较注意,各位老铁们都需要剖析一些“每天5分钟玩转docker容器技术 pdf百度云”的相关内容。那么小编同时在网络上网罗了一些有关“每天5分钟玩转docker容器技术 pdf百度云””的相关文章,希望小伙伴们能喜欢,兄弟们快快来了解一下吧!前言:
Docker背后的想法是很简单的,创建一 个轻量级的虚拟环境,称之为容器,其仅持有你的应用程序及其依赖。Docker Engine使用主机操作系统来构建和管理这些容器。它们易于安装、管理和删除,容器内运行的应用程序共享资源,使得它们的足迹很微小。
今天要给大家分享的是《Docker实战》PDF,他会教会读者如何创建、部署和管理Docker容器托管的应用程序,在以一个清晰透彻的对于Docker模式的开篇介绍之后,你将会学到如何在容器内打包应用,包括测试和分发应用的技术。你还将学习如何编排容器和应用程序以及它们的安装和卸载。
本PDF使用精心设计的示例教你如何从安装、删除到编排容器和应用程序。从开发和测试机器到全面的云服务部署的这些领域一路走下来,你会发现使用Docker的各种技术。
本书包括的内容:为部署打包容器安装、管理和删除容器使用Docker镜像使用Docker Hub分发
读者只需要有Linux操作系统的工作经验,学习本书之前不需要知道Docker。
接下来我会截取文档中部分的内容像你展示,如果你需要学习docker,可以跳跃到文末查看这份文档的获取方式! 领取之后好好学习一下!
欢迎来到Docker世界
Docker包括一个命令行程序、一个后台守护进程,以及一组远程服务。它解决了常见的软件问题,并简化了安装、运行、发布和删除软件。这一切能够实现是通过使用一项UNIX技术,称为容器。
不仅仅是Linux Docker 是一款Linux 软件,但可以很好地运行在大多数操作系统上
镜像发布:如何打包软件
在镜像中打包软件
从一个容器构建一个镜像的基础工作流包含三部分:
第一,你需要从一个已存在的镜像创建一个容器。至于选什么镜像,这需要根据你最终想要将哪些东西包含到新镜像中,以及需要哪些修改镜像的工具来决定。
第二,修改这个容器的文件系统。这些改动会被保存在容器的联合文件系统的新文件层。在本章后面的内容中,我们会再次回顾镜像、文件层(layer)、 还有仓库(repository)之间的关系。
第三,一旦改动完成,那么就要将这些改动提交(commit)。一旦改动被提交,你就能够从新镜像创建新的容器了。如下图所示描绘了这个工作流。
如果你想要的来找我获取到这一份Docker学习文档的话,麻烦转发本文加关注我后私信回复【文档】来免费获取到!
多容器和多主机环境
用一个简单的开发环境入门
假设你以在成熟项目的团队中的一名软件开发人员的身份开始了一个新工作,如果在以往的这种类似情况下,你可能会觉得要花几天时间安装和配置IDE, 并在你的工作计算器上运行一个可操作的开发环境,但是在这里工作的第一天, 你的同事给了你三个简单的指令就可以开始了
安装Docker安装 Docker Compose安装和使用Git来克隆开发环境
而不是要求你在这里克隆一个 开发环境,我会让你创建一一个名为wp-example 的新目录,并复制以下的docker .compose.yml文件到这个目录:
Docker 公司近来的发展令人感到惋惜,但 Docker 引擎却更值得人们关注。Docker 的出现,是容器技术如此流行的真正原因,但如今 Kubernetes 却成为了容器编排工具的首选。不过即便如此,Docker 引擎仍旧有机会赶上 Kubernetes 的步伐。
我们为什么要学会使用docker呢?
使用Docker最重要的一点就是Docker能保证运行环境的一致性,不会出现开发、测试、生产由于环境配置不一致导致的各种问题,一次配置多次运行。使用Docker,可更快地打包、测试以及部署应用程序,并可减少从编写到部署运行代码的周期。
SO,如果你想要的来找我获取到这一份Docker学习文档的话,麻烦转发本文加关注我后私信回复【文档】来免费获取到!